My research interests are spatial-temporal data mining, artificial intelligence in the field of transportation engineering, and transportation network analysis. My recent works have focused on developing models for traffic forecasting in urban areas using Graph Neural Networks and time-series models such as LSTM and causal convolution. Recently, I have been investigating the field of AI-based maritime transportation, including vessel intention prediction, weather routing, and smart port operation.
I am currently a postdoc at KAIST (Korea Advanced Institute of Science and Technology, Daejeon, South Korea) TRUE Lab. I received my Ph.D. from KAIST Civil and Environmental Engineering advised by Yoonjin Yoon. I also received my Bachelor's degree from KAIST.
